Course Content

• Understanding the Diverse Educational Landscapes of the Middle East
• Curriculum Development and Assessment in Arab Contexts
• Middle Eastern Education Systems: History, Policies, and Reforms
• Integrating Technology in Middle Eastern Classrooms (EdTech)
• Special Education Needs and Inclusive Practices in the Middle East
• Cultural Sensitivity and Intercultural Communication in Education
• The Role of Religion and Tradition in Middle Eastern Education
• Challenges and Opportunities in Higher Education in the Middle East
